http://www.betfredbritishmasters.com/index-406.html WebDec 7, 2024 · To cite a TED Talk from the TED site, list the speaker as author, give the date listed on the site, include “Video” in square brackets after the title, list the publisher as “TED Conferences,” and give the URL. WebFeb 23, 2016 · In-text citation: TED (2013) or (TED, 2013) YouTube shows the date that the video was posted as March 1, 2013, so that's the date to use in this reference. The author name is TED in this case because the TED organization posted the video to YouTube, and that’s the information your reader needs to retrieve the reference. WebNov 2, 2024 · For MLA in-text citations, if the author and uploader are the same entity, begin your in-text citation with the title of the video in quotation marks, followed by the timestamp range. No comma separates the elements.
